Wine has been an integral part of cultures around the world for centuries, not just for its taste but also for its potential wellness benefits.​ From the vineyards of Italy to the cellars of France, wine has been celebrated not just as a beverage but as a symbol of good health and vitality.​ The Mediterranean diet, which emphasizes a glass of wine with meals, has been hailed as one of the healthiest diets in the world.​

But it’s important to remember that moderation is key when it comes to reaping the benefits of wine.​ The health benefits associated with wine are seen in moderate consumption, typically defined as one glass per day for women and up to two glasses per day for men.​ Drinking in excess can lead to a range of health issues, including liver disease, addiction, and an increased risk of accidents.​

Wine: From Vine to Glass

Have you ever wondered about the process behind the creation of your favorite bottle of wine? It all begins in the vineyards, where the grapes are carefully nurtured and harvested at the peak of ripeness.​ Skilled winemakers then work their magic, using a combination of traditional methods and modern techniques to transform the grapes into wine.​

Once the grapes are harvested, they are crushed and the juice is extracted.​ Fermentation, the process of converting sugar into alcohol, then takes center stage.​ Depending on the desired style of wine, the grapes may be fermented with the skins or without, resulting in variations in color and flavor.​

After fermentation, the young wine is typically aged in oak barrels or stainless steel tanks.​ This aging process allows the flavors and aromas to develop and mellow, adding complexity to the final product.​ Finally, the wine is bottled and, after sufficient aging, it is ready to delight wine enthusiasts around the world.​

From vineyard to glass, each step in the winemaking process contributes to the unique characteristics and flavors that make wine such a beloved beverage.​ So, the next time you uncork a bottle of wine, take a moment to appreciate the dedication and craftsmanship that went into its creation.​

Exploring the World of Wine

As you embark on your journey through the world of wine, you’ll discover a vast array of regions, grape varieties, and styles that offer something for every palate.​ From the vineyards of Napa Valley to the rolling hills of Tuscany, each wine region brings its own unique terroir, climate, and winemaking traditions.​

Red wine enthusiasts can explore the bold flavors of Cabernet Sauvignon from California, the elegant and earthy Pinot Noir from Burgundy, or the robust and spicy Malbec from Argentina.​ White wine lovers can indulge in the crisp and zesty Sauvignon Blanc from New Zealand, the aromatic and floral Riesling from Germany, or the rich and buttery Chardonnay from California.​

If you’re feeling adventurous, why not discover the world of sparkling wines? From the celebrated Champagne region of France to the vibrant and fruity Prosecco from Italy, sparkling wines offer a touch of effervescence to any occasion.​
